## Limits & Quotas — Spoolwright

Welcome aboard! Spoolwright is our printer-spooler microservice, and yes, it has opinions about how much you can throw at it. Each tenant gets a capped job queue, oversized documents get chunked, and anything past the rate limit gets a polite 429. Most of these caps came from the Great Pamphlet Flood incident, so don't raise them casually — ask in the team channel first. Here are the current defaults we ship.

constants for fajop-tahaf:
RATE_LIMITS = {
    "holael": 2,
    "oliael": 10,
    "druael": 10,
    "wenwyn": 10,
}

# Fonts: vendoring policy for the Thimbleworks environments

We vendor all third-party display fonts into the asset tree rather than loading them from an external host. This keeps staging and production byte-identical and avoids license-check flakiness at build time. Reviewers: confirm the license file ships alongside each font family, and that the subsetting step ran (check the woff2 sizes). Each environment pins its font bundle via the configuration shown here.

settings of fafog-haduf:
ZORIX_PIN=4648
ZORIX_METRICS_HOST=metrics.zorix.paliqsys.corp
ZORIX_LOG_LEVEL=info
ZORIX_TENANT=druix

Flagging this for plugin authors: the Larkspin JS SDK now matches the Kotlin SDK's retry semantics, so plugins no longer need their own backoff wrappers. Both clients honor the same jitter and cap behavior, and the deprecated `retryHint` field is ignored. Any plugin overriding these should migrate to the shared defaults, which are now.

tuning constants:
QUOTAS = {
    "druwyn": 5,
    "holix": 5,
    "zorath": 5,
    "holwyn": 10,
}

## Releases

The Cobbleworth billing worker ships via blue-green deploys. Each release builds two identical environments; traffic shifts to green only after the reconciliation probes pass for ten consecutive minutes, and blue is kept warm for instant rollback. Plugin authors should note that both environments load plugins at boot, so your plugin must tolerate running briefly in a drained environment. Plugins are only loaded if their archive is signed and the signature verifies against our published release key, which is as follows.

signing key of bagap-yawep = bky13_TbfT6ZMUoGJo2